National wide conferences to increase awareness on FP7 |
| Several conferences are scheduled for the next period in many European countries to activate organizations (in both public and private sectors) to participate in research under the 7th Framework Program for R&D of the EU (2007-2013). These stimulatory events are aiming at increasing knowledge regarding the activities foreseen under FP7 as well as the rules for participation in these activities. Indicative list of events:

We would like to inform You about the Inauguration of the 7th Framework Programme in Poland which will take place in Warsaw on 16-17 November 2006. The Conference will be held under the honorary patronage of the President of Republic of Poland Mr. Lech Kaczyński. During the conference the objectives of the 7th Framework Programme will be presented taking into consideration its budget of 54 milliard Euro. The conference will provide basic information about major aims, rules of participation, budget and structure of FP7. This event will enable to establish contacts among Polish and foreign research and industrial groups interested in creating consortia that prepare the projects for FP7. Moreover, the conference will also provide the strengthening of European cooperation in the area of Social Sciences and Humanities research, including the promotion of Polish technological and research initiatives. The conference will also serve as an occasion to summarize the participation of Polish teams in FP6 and award the most active and successful participants. During the Framework Ball, on the 16th of November, the prestigious awards Crystal Brussels will be distributed in six categories: universities, Polish Academy of Sciences, research and development units, industry, SMEs and Individual Award. Organizers cordially encourage you to take part in the Inauguration of the 7th Framework Programme in Poland. This event will bring result with more active participation of Polish teams in FP7. National information event of the German Ministry of Education The national information event of the German Ministry of Education regarding the 7th framework programme of the EU will take place on 15th and 16th January 2007 in the international convention centre Bundeshaus Bonn. On the first day, high-ranking international lectures will present the whole new framework programme. The second day offers a range of workshops and the possibility to deepen information concerning the framework programme. Hints for applicants will be given. This event is the first presentation of the Ministry which deals with the topic “research” in the context of the German EU presidency 2007.
